Soil Instability and Erosion
Coastal soil is often loose, sandy, or saturated with water. This instability makes it difficult to create strong foundations. Erosion caused by tides, waves, and storms can gradually wash away soil around structures, increasing the risk of settlement or collapse. Effective coastal construction incorporates deep foundations, reinforced pilings, and soil stabilization techniques to maintain structural integrity.
Materials That Can Withstand the Elements
Saltwater and coastal moisture are relentless on standard construction materials. Metals can corrode, wood can rot, and concrete can deteriorate over time. Coastal construction requires materials that resist these conditions, such as:
- Marine-grade concrete for piers and seawalls
- Stainless steel or coated metals for structural supports
- Treated wood or composite materials for decking and exposed surfaces
- Protective coatings to reduce moisture penetration
Using the right materials ensures long-term durability and reduces maintenance costs.
Designing for Wind and Storms
Strong winds and storms are another major challenge near the ocean. Coastal construction must account for:
- High wind pressure on walls, roofs, and windows
- Storm surges that can flood low-lying areas
- Impact from floating debris during extreme weather
Structural designs often include reinforced connections, elevated buildings, and aerodynamic shapes to reduce wind pressure. Planning for these factors keeps structures safe during extreme weather events.
Controlling Water Flow and Flooding
Managing water is a central concern in coastal construction. Heavy rains, tides, and storm surges can cause flooding and damage. Coastal construction uses strategies such as:
- Drainage channels to direct water away from foundations
- Elevated platforms or stilts for buildings
- Flood barriers and levees in vulnerable areas
- Landscaping and vegetation to absorb runoff
Proper water management helps protect both structures and the surrounding land from long-term damage.
